Dept. of Natural Resources: Approves master plan variance to expand barrens habitat at Brule River State Forest

MADISON, Wis. – The Wisconsin Department of Natural Resources (DNR) has approved a variance to the Brule River State Forest Master Plan to allow additional barrens habitat management in the Mott’s Ravine Native Community Management Area at Brule River State Forest. Dept. of Public Instruction: Submits list of recommended early literacy curricula to Joint Committee on Finance for approval

MADISON — In accordance with 2023 Wisconsin Act 20, the Wisconsin Department of Public Instruction on Monday submitted a memo to the Joint Committee on Finance that includes a list of recommended early literacy curricula for use in kindergarten to third grade.
